While truck drivers have tons of steel protecting them on the road, they can still be in danger. There are some safety tips to help ensure truck drivers are safe on the roads, and that makes the safer for everyone else in small vehicles as well. A truck driver needs to take care of his or her own needs before anything else. Failing to get enough rest, not eating properly, and not getting enough exercise can all affect a person physically and mentally.

Taking care of the truck they are driving is very important as well. There is plenty of routine maintenance that needs to be done on a semi truck. This includes checking the fluids, checking hoses, changing the oil, and looking for any leaks or problems. Tires need to be in good condition so they don’t blow out. We have all seen though large pieces of rubber on the roads that come off of big trucks. These can create a hazard for other drivers when they are driving behind a big truck.
